On May 21, 2015, the registrant held its annual meeting of stockholders. The three matters presented to the stockholders at the annual meeting were (1) the election of six directors, (2) the ratification of the appointment of PricewaterhouseCoopers LLP as auditors for 2015, and (3) an advisory vote to approve executive compensation.
